This lively character is working hard to entertain. Found on St. Swithun’s building in Magdalen College, Oxford, he is one of many humorous and imaginative gargoyles which must have kept the stonemasons amused during its construction. During medieval and Tudor times musicians, troubadours, jugglers and jesters travelled to courts and around the country providing popular entertainment.
